Human Resource Intern

Insperity is a leading provider of HR solutions, dedicated to making a difference for businesses and communities across the U.S. They are seeking a Human Resource Intern to gain hands-on experience in compliance-based HR services while engaging in various projects and assignments relevant to the company's needs.

Responsibilities

Learns through completion of work assignments by applying up-to-date knowledge in subject area to meet deadlines; following procedures and policies, and applying data and resources to support projects or initiatives; collaborating with others, often cross-functionally, to solve business problems; supporting the completion of priorities, deadlines, and expectations; communicating progress and information; identifying and recommending ways to address improvement opportunities when possible; and escalating issues or risks as appropriate
Work assignments may include support with projects such as handbooks, policy development, implementing time off tracking, and other foundational HR compliance items for new and existing clients to enhance productivity and reduce liability
Interacts directly with colleagues, clientele, and/or other internal or external constituencies in the planning of assignments and the resolution of day-to-day operational problems
Receives guidance, training, and mentoring from professional personnel in planning and carrying out activities and assignments
Pursues self-development and effective relationships with others by sharing resources, information, and knowledge with coworkers and customers; listening, responding to, and seeking performance feedback; acknowledging strengths and weaknesses; assessing and responding to the needs of others; and adapting to and learning from change, difficulties, and feedback. Contributes to the completion of projects and department objectives as specified by the manager
As appropriate to the position and as specified by unit management, conducts original research and prepares reports based on findings, to include recommendations or alternative proposals for action
May undertake related studies or enrichment programs as appropriate to the specific objectives of the operating unit
Provides ongoing feedback on improvements and upgrades to the program
